I have a Dr. Who was called to see a pt. in the E.R. late Aug. 10th and did and h&p and then found out pt. wasn't admitted until Aug. 11th. What are the guidelines for dos to code for? If the h&p is billed with admit date of the 11th and the documentation states the 10th there will be issues with admit date.

Also, If Dr. sees patient on the 10th and does h&p and requests a special bed and pt. isn't admitted until the 11 which dos should be coded?

Any help or guidelines would be appreciated.:confused:
 
The admit would be coded based on the documentation. It doesn't matter if the hospital didn't have a bed on that calendar date.

The same thing is true for the reverse, if the patient is in a bed on the 10th but the H&P isn't done until the 11th, the date the documentation supports is the date you bill.

This is old but still valid and the exact situation you are dealing with. The following was on the bottom of page 2 on the link.

http://www.wpsmedicare.com/part_b/publications/1002comm.pdf

Q6. I admitted a patient to a hospital in the late evening on a Tuesday, but I did not actually see the
patient until Wednesday morning. What is the date of service for the initial hospital visit (CPT
99221-99223)?
A6. If you performed the service on Wednesday morning, you should bill for it as a Wednesday date of
service
